Marti Jurmain
Director, Research and Innovation
Niagara College

Marti Jurmain is currently the Director, Research and Innovation at Niagara College in southern Ontario. In her portfolio, she is the major institutional leader responsible for furthering the research priorities and building the capacity and culture for research at the College. Working with both academic and non-academic units in the College, Marti promotes research initiatives, administers grants, leads institutional research as well as applied research activities, and develops research and related policies and procedures. She is responsible for public and private sector partnership development in support of research and innovation activities, and for liaison with funders and associations linked to research.

Marti holds a Master of Arts degree and an undergraduate honours degree in English as well as teaching certification from the University of Western Ontario. She has held a number of portfolios at Niagara College, including faculty, academic director, and director of new product development. Marti has been active in various provincial and Canada-wide committees related to education, literacy, labour adjustment, and college level research.
